Question: Which molecule exhibits sp hybridization?

Options:

  1. CCl4
  2. CO2
  3. NH3
  4. H2O

Correct Answer: CO2

Solution:

In CO2, the carbon atom is sp hybridized as it forms two double bonds with oxygen.

Which molecule exhibits sp hybridization?
Correct Answer: CO2
  • Step 1: Understand what hybridization means. Hybridization is the mixing of atomic orbitals to form new hybrid orbitals.
  • Step 2: Identify the types of hybridization. Common types include sp, sp2, and sp3.
  • Step 3: Know that sp hybridization occurs when one s orbital and one p orbital mix, resulting in two sp hybrid orbitals.
  • Step 4: Look at the molecule CO2 (carbon dioxide). It consists of one carbon atom and two oxygen atoms.
  • Step 5: Determine the bonding in CO2. The carbon atom forms two double bonds with the two oxygen atoms.
  • Step 6: Recognize that to form two double bonds, the carbon atom needs to use two sp hybrid orbitals.
  • Step 7: Conclude that since carbon in CO2 forms two double bonds, it is sp hybridized.
